溫馨提示×

kafka producer參數兼容性嗎

小樊
98
2024-12-14 06:41:02
欄目: 大數據

Kafka Producer的參數兼容性在不同版本之間存在差異??傮w而言,Kafka Producer的參數兼容性較好,大多數參數在不同版本間保持一致,但某些參數在不同版本間的默認值或功能上可能有所變化。以下是詳細介紹:

Kafka Producer 參數兼容性概述

  • 版本兼容性:Kafka Producer的API自0.8版本引入以來,經歷了多次迭代和改進。0.9版本增加了對SSL和SASL的認證支持,0.10版本引入了ProducerInterceptor等。這些版本更新帶來了一些API的變化,但在大多數情況下,這些變化是向后兼容的。
  • 版本選擇建議:對于新項目,建議使用Kafka的最新版本,以利用最新的特性和性能優化。對于現有項目,升級到新版本前應評估API變更對現有代碼的影響,必要時進行代碼遷移。

參數變化說明

  • 壓縮類型:在0.8版本中,壓縮類型是通過compression.type參數設置的,而在0.9版本中,引入了compression.type=gzip、compression.type=snappy等具體的壓縮類型。這些變化使得Kafka Producer可以更靈活地選擇壓縮算法。
  • 認證支持:從0.9版本開始,Kafka增加了對SSL和SASL的認證支持,這是通過security.protocol參數來配置的。這一變化增強了數據傳輸的安全性,但也要求客戶端和服務器端進行相應的配置。

兼容性測試建議

  • 在進行版本升級時,建議進行充分的兼容性測試,確保新版本Kafka Producer能夠正常工作,并且不會破壞現有系統的穩定性。

通過上述分析,我們可以看出Kafka Producer的參數兼容性整體上是良好的,但在進行版本升級時,仍需注意一些參數和功能的變化,以確保系統的平穩過渡。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女